    Those are simply beautiful! The yellow ones are my favorite. I've got one rose bush that hasn't bloomed in a year or so. Then it started growing all wild. I just trimmed it and I know it was at the wrong time. You have any suggestions? I'm normally a plant killer so I can't believe it's lived this long.
    You should trim the stems right after the blooms die.It helps the bush from over growing and it keeps the blooms down lower. The yellow bush needs to be trimmed but theres way too many blooms to trim it right now. The owners before left us some plant food that we give to the Roses. I'm not sure what brand they are but i'll go check later. Both the back & front bushes have full sunlight, so that may help too.
